Nick Johnston - The Captain Meets
Nick Johnston is part of a new wave of guitar virtuosos, renowned for his slick legato style and moving, soulful instrumental music. The Canadian already has five full-length albums to his name, and his latest release (2019's "Wide Eyes In The Dark") is considered his most accomplished yet.
Not only has Nick established a large online presence over the years, but he can also be seen out on the road supporting the likes of Between The Buried And Me, The Contortionist and Polyphia. Guest spots on tracks from Periphery, Intervals and Scale The Summit bolster his impressive list of credentials, which continues to grow into 2020 and beyond.
Back in 2015, Nick sat down with The Captain back to discuss his career and the early days as an up-and-coming musician aspiring for recognition. Other topics included Johnston's relationship with Schecter guitars and tips on how to get your parents to support you!

Misha Mansoor - The Captain Meets
Misha Mansoor is the founder of modern metal pioneers Periphery; trendsetters of the "djent" genre. As one of the most recognised and accomplished guitarists in the game today, we were fortunate enough to catch up with "Bulb" back in 2015 during his sold-out UK clinic tour.
In one of our most popular episodes of 'The Captain Meets' thus far, Lee certainly didn't hold back and asked Misha about his influences, signature Jackson/Bare Knuckle gear and how to face criticism!

Martin Harley - The Captain Meets
Armed with his lap steel guitar, Coodercaster and bottleneck slide, Martin Harley has carved out a distinct tone inspired by the stirring sounds of delta blues and Americana. His last two albums were recorded in Nashville, the spiritual home of American folk and country music.
Alongside his own solo material, Martin has performed with the likes of Eric Clapton, Van Morrison and Laura Marling among others. He stopped by the Andertons TV studio to catch up with his old pal, our very own Captain Anderton - cue conversations about wanderlust, slide guitar tunings, the Nashville experience and much, much more...

Yvette Young - The Captain Meets
Yvette Young is one of guitar music’s rising stars. Making music both as a solo artist and with math-rock trio Covet, her unique style combines two-hand tapping with open tunings and chiming clean tones, influenced by her background as a classically-trained pianist and violinist. Yvette sat down with the Captain in the Andertons studio to talk about gear, inspiration, motivation and life itself.
